Investment business SouthernPlex Group has taken a strategic stake in AirProtect. The investment will enable AirProtect to enter the aircraft services sector, providing detailing, protective coatings and maintenance services for private airports, aircraft owners and operators, and help it scale operations across Texas.
“Aircraft detailing and maintenance is about more than appearance; it’s about preserving asset value and operational readiness,” says Tim Warner, founder of AirProtect. “Our partnership with SouthernPlex is a launchpad to bring elevated service to general aviation clients across Texas.”
AirProtect, a veteran-owned business, offers exterior washes, brightwork polishing, paint revival, window restoration, interior detailing, leather conditioning, protective coatings, sanitisation and hangar-based maintenance support. Its approach draws from best practices in detailing and restoration, focusing on precision, quality materials and reduced downtime.
Preston Howell, CEO of SouthernPlex, says, “We are thrilled to be aligned with Mr. Warner and AirProtect’s impressive positioning and overall vision. We believe that AirProtect’s focus on craftsmanship and operational rigour will fill a premium niche in maintaining and detailing aircraft across this dynamic market.”
AirProtect plans to expand into broader maintenance services, including partnerships with FBOs, MROs and private airport operators to deliver on-site support and concierge services. The company aims to grow within airport ecosystems and expand into neighbouring states as operations scale.
